Curriculum

Required courses in the humanities, social sciences, and physical sciences can be transferred from another college, waived, challenged, or earned at Rutgers, The State University of New Jersey.

Selected nursing courses in the nursing major can be transferred from another college, waived, challenged, or earned at Rutgers.

College of Nursing degree candidates must complete a minimum of 30 of the terminal 42 credits toward the degree at the college.
